The note of Onyx, being an abstract and conceptual accord rather than a literal botanical extract, manifests as a profound mineralic depth. It is typically a cool, smooth, and stony presence, evoking the tactile sensation of polished, dark rock. The aroma is often characterized by a subtle, damp earthiness, reminiscent of petrichor clinging to ancient stone after a sudden rain, coupled with a faint, almost metallic coolness that speaks of subterranean chambers and quiet strength. There's an absence of sweetness or overt warmth; instead, it offers a stark, clean, yet grounding character. Its intensity is generally subdued, existing as a foundational element rather than a booming top note, preferring to anchor and provide texture. Projection is typically intimate, radiating a quiet authority. Longevity is excellent, as it resides firmly in the base, evolving slowly to reveal its inherent nuances over many hours, often becoming more earthy and profound as other notes recede.
